Five policemen escape after bail pleas dismissal
2012-01-25
[Dawn] Five coppers, including a DSP, managed to escape following the dismissal of their pre-arrest bail applications by a district and sessions court in a custodial killing case on Monday.

The five coppers -- DSP Hafeez Junejo, Inspector Hadi Bux, Sub-Inspector Malik Mohammad Ashraf and Assistant Sub-Inspectors Aftab Ahmed and Chaudhry Javed Akthar -- have been booked for their alleged involvement in the killing of a suspect, Krishan Chand, who was found dead in the Sharea Faisal cop shoppe's lock-up on Nov 4, 2008.

Earlier, the Sindh High Court had granted interim pre-arrest bail to the police officials. Later, the matter was referred to the district and sessions judge (east) with a direction to decide it.

On a previous hearing, the court heard arguments from both sides on the bail pleas and reserved the matter for confirmation or otherwise for Jan 23.

District and Sessions Judge (east) Sadiq Hussain Bhatti dismissed the pre-arrest bail applications of the suspects on Monday.

As soon as the court pronounced its order, the suspects managed to escape from the courtroom without facing any resistance as the investigation officer of the case apparently made no effort to arrest them.
